Output f98582808c89edd03dfe290cf7539c013bfbc9130d78327339c12c2b39dd2d8a:0

value
625605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aab3f69048ff3fee25cb3d2b273674e454a42e6 OP_EQUAL
address
3Fnq8aqPD23Xj9oVDYktECExWzbrazwKq9
transaction
f98582808c89edd03dfe290cf7539c013bfbc9130d78327339c12c2b39dd2d8a